Associate Editorial Supervisor

Position Overview The Associate Editorial Supervisor oversees workflow and begins to oversee staff and freelance across multiple brands. They also lead the editorial process, provide constructive feedback and evaluate work. They are highly skilled in managing brands and clients, cultivating relationships, and enhancing their reputation.

Responsibilities

  • Assist with editing, fact-checking, and proofreading a range of promotional and educational materials targeted at healthcare professionals, physicians, and patients, from manuscript through prepress.
  • Support multiple projects simultaneously while overseeing the work of junior editors and freelancers.
  • Help triage print and digital materials, providing guidance on routing and suggesting improvements for efficient workflow.
  • Develop a strong understanding of various brands' science, competitors, client style, and relevant editorial standards, including AMA style, grammar, and usage.
  • Begin to manage the timing and quality control of editorial projects, ensuring accurate copy editing, styling, and fact-checking processes are followed.
  • Participate in performance reviews, learning to guide team members through goal-setting and offering hands-on support in their professional development.
  • Support training initiatives on Best Practices, quality improvement, and effective use of editorial tools and technology.
  • Communicate effectively with supervisors and internal teams to ensure smooth editorial operations.
  • Represent the Editorial department in client meetings, including Agency Day events and tours, supporting the team’s presence and client engagement.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s or advanced degree in English, Journalism, Life Sciences, or related field.
  • Strong knowledge of AMA style and industry regulations (FDA, OPDP, etc.).
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and organizational skills.
  • Experience working in a fast-paced agency or medical communications setting.
  • Organization, attention to detail, and the ability to oversee and handle numerous products at once essential.
  • Curiosity/interest in medical topics essential.
